Continue ReadingPlaying college basketball at any level is a big achievement. In North Dakota, we do not have many players that make the jump all the way to D1. It does happen and it has been happening more often lately. In this article, we will look at players in North Dakota that have the skills and potential to play Division-1 basketball.
Alphabetically here is our list of players that we think can play D1 basketball:
Anthony Doppler Anthony Doppler 6'4" | SG Bismarck Century | 2023 State ND (2023) |6-3 G| Bismarck Century – AAU team= ND Phenom. A big strong and physical guard. Anthony has the size and skill to play at the next level. His shooting ability and range extend out beyond the college arc. He has the vertical to play above the rim and he can wham it home with authority. With a great showing in the AAU season, I would not be surprised if he gets looks from D1 schools.
Carson Hegerle Carson Hegerle 6'3" | SG West Fargo | 2022 State ND (2022) |6-3 G| West Fargo – Him and the Packers won the State Title. Carson had a phenomenal season and tournament. Hegerle is a scoring machine. He is a dynamic athlete who belongs in a D1 sport. Carson has been getting a ton of interest and multiple D1 offers for football. Right now, it seems like he will be playing football at the next level. If he ever changes his mind, he could also play D1 basketball.
Conner Kraft Conner Kraft 6'5" | PF Shanley | 2023 State ND (2023) |6-6 F| Shanley – AAU team= Howard Pulley. A powerful and explosive athlete. He showed off his athletic prowess this season in the EDC. I witnessed many rim-rocking slam dunks that left me in awe. As his game develops and his shooting improves, he will be and absolute nightmare. After a spring/summer with Pulley and competing against other great athletes I would imagine he will be a different player. I see him as a Mid-Major prospect or higher.
Gus Hurlburt Gus Hurlburt 6'9" | PF Enderlin | 2022 State ND (2022) |6-7 F| Enderlin – AAU team= D1 Minnesota. He is receiving interest from Summit League teams and has 1 offer. Gus is a well-rounded player that can do it all. He has handles, passing ability, strong post moves, and a consistent shoot. He has a nose for the ball when rebounding. I see him getting more interest from Summit League teams and other Mid-Major schools this spring/summer.
Jeremiah Sem Jeremiah Sem 6'3" | SG Fargo North | 2024 State #303 Nation ND (2024) |6-1 G| Fargo North – AAU team= ECI Prospects. A magnificent athlete that moves like very few players can. He is on a different level athletically compared to everyone else in the state. Sem showed last year that he can take over games in the EDC and dominate. After more college scouts watch him first-hand, they will be drooling. I am projecting him to be a Power-5 high D1 recruit.
Joe Hurlburt Joe Hurlburt 6'10" | PF Enderlin | 2022 State #147 Nation MN (2022) |6-9 F| Enderlin – AAU team= D1 Minnesota. He has verbally committed to Colorado. Joe will be playing in the PAC-12 after his season. He has offers from big D1 schools all over the country. He obviously has the size to play D1. Hurlburt also has the skills of a shooting guard, and he is very smart. His deep outlet passes are the best I have seen from a high school player. After his senior season is over it will be fun to look back at his highlight tape, it will be one for the ages.
Mason Klabo Mason Klabo 6'2" | PG Fargo Davies | 2025 State #240 Nation ND (2025) |6-1 G| Fargo Davies – AAU team = Team Tyus. Only an 8th grader but he held his own in the EDC and excelled at times on varsity. The sky is the limit with Klabo. At 6’1” and in 8th grade, he is already dunking. I expect him to keep growing quite a bit. Mason is a lethal 3-point shooter with extended range. His confidence is impressive. I am not going to predict what level of D1 he will get offers from with him only in 8th grade. His ceiling is very high, and I can absolutely see him as a D1 player in the future.
Trey Brandt Trey Brandt 6'1" | PG Beulah | 2022 State ND (2022) |6-1 G| Beulah – AAU team= Pentagon Schoolers. He is receiving interest from multiple D2 schools. Trey is the ultimate point guard and leader. He is a clutch performer and an ultimate competitor. He thrives in big moments. Brandt is a gym rat. He has all the tools and ability to play D1. Trey is an underrated athlete. After college coaches see him up close this spring and summer, I expect the D1 offers to start coming in from Summit League teams and Mid-major programs very soon.
Treysen Eaglestaff Treysen Eaglestaff 6'5" | SF Bismark | 2022 State ND (2022) |6-5 F| Bismarck – AAU team= D1 Minnesota. He is receiving interest from the Summit League and he has an offer. He certainly passes the “eye test”. If you watch him play for 5 minutes you will know he is a stud basketball player. He is a light’s out shooter with a great feel for the game. I predict he gets many Summit and Mid-Major offers this spring/summer.
